On Wed, Feb 15, 2017, at 01:32 PM, BVpTuvb AVMV wrote: > What is preventing an attacker to start up a few mid-nodes and > enumerating all IPs and substracting those from the list of publicly > known entry-nodes to get a list of (all) unlisted bridges? > > Seems a lot cheaper than dpi and except for a few false positives due to > bots pinging it should be quite accurate is this an inherent and known > flaw to the bridge infrastructure that we have to live with or am i > missing some keypoint? > -- Bridges are indistinguishable from clients, of which there are millions.
